A good quality Edwardian marquetry inlaid mahogany envelope card table, the quartered square top with secret opening mechanism to reveal a baize lined interior and four copper lined counter wells, fitted with a single frieze drawer, four ogee supports, pierced x-shaped stretcher, and brass casters, 55cm square by 75cm high.
